Как можно оптимизировать создание забора в Blender 3D?

Какими способами можно оптимизировать данный забор, используя минимальное количество полигонов, при этом не ухудшая качество модели? Я видел видео о том, как в «Бэтмен: Аркхэм Оригинс» для создания эффекта объема использовали две одинаковые текстуры забора, размещенные друг за другом. Есть ли другие методы и приемы для снижения количества полигонов без значительной потери качества?
  • 4 февраля 2025 г. 17:34
Ответы на вопрос 1
Оптимизация модели забора в Blender 3D с целью снижения количества полигонов без ухудшения качества может быть достигнута различными способами. Вот несколько методов, которые могут помочь:

1. **Использование текстур вместо геометрии**:
   - Вместо создания сложной геометрии для деталей забора (например, болтов, пропилов и т.д.) можно использовать текстуры, такие как нормальные карты (normal maps) или дисplacements. Это позволяет создавать эффект объема и деталей, не добавляя дополнительные полигоны.

2. **Создание высокополигональной модели и ретопология**:
   - Создайте высокополигональную версию забора для детальной проработки, а затем выполните ретопологию, чтобы получить низкополигонажную модель. Это позволяет сохранить основные формы и детали, в то время как количество полигонов значительно снижается.

3. **Использование LOD (Level of Detail)**:
   - Создайте несколько версий модели с различными уровнями детализации (высокая, средняя, низкая). В зависимости от расстояния до камеры используйте соответствующую версию. Это особенно полезно в игровых движках.

4. **Групповая геометрия**:
   - Если забор состоит из повторяющихся элементов (например, секций), создайте один элемент с правильно сделанными UV-развёртками, который можно дублировать по мере необходимости. Это уменьшит количество уникальных вершин.

5. **Использование модификаторов**:
   - Используйте модификаторы, такие как "Array" и "Mirror". Эти модификаторы позволяют создавать множество копий модели, не создавая новых полигонов в сцене.

6. **Декализация**:
   - Вместо создания полигонов для дополнительных деталей на заборе, таких как песок или грязь, можно использовать текстуры-декали (decals), которые монтируются на поверхность забора.

7. **Оптимизация UV-развёрток**:
   - Убедитесь, что UV-развёртки ваших текстур использованы эффективно, позволяя более низкому полигональному счету отображать высокое качество текстур.

8. **Сокращение количества элементов**:
   - Проверьте, можно ли объединить элементы модели или удалить ненужные детали, которые могут быть визуально неприметными на расстоянии.

9. **Использование альфа-текстур**:
   - Для создания эффекта прозрачности или тонких деталей в заборе можете использовать альфа-текстуры. Например, детали, которые не нужны в 3D, могут быть смоделированы в текстуре.

Используя эти методы, можно значительно оптимизировать забор в Blender, повысив производительность и сохранив при этом визуальное качество.
Похожие вопросы